Product Description

Enhance your garden borders with Tower Columbine flower seeds. Known for their elegant, spurred blooms and vertical growth habit, Tower Columbine is perfect for adding height and color to borders, cottage gardens, and perennial beds. These premium heirloom seeds are non-GMO and carefully selected for reliable germination and vigorous growth, ideal for gardeners seeking low-maintenance, ornamental flowers.

Specifications:

  • Plant Type: Perennial

  • Flower Color: Various shades including pink, red, purple, and white (varies by variety)

  • Growth Habit: Upright, vertical

  • Ideal Zones: USDA Hardiness Zones 3–8

  • Height: 24–48 inches (60–120 cm)

  • Germination: 14–21 days under optimal conditions

Planting & Sowing Instructions:

  1. Sowing Indoors: Start seeds indoors 6–8 weeks before the last frost. Lightly press seeds onto well-draining seed-starting soil; do not cover completely.

  2. Sowing Outdoors: Direct sow after frost risk has passed into full sun to partial shade with well-drained soil.

  3. Temperature: Maintain 65–70°F (18–21°C) for optimal germination.

  4. Watering: Keep soil lightly moist until seedlings establish.

  5. Spacing: Space plants 12–18 inches (30–45 cm) apart for healthy growth and airflow.

  6. Sunlight: Full sun to partial shade; Tower Columbine thrives in bright conditions.

  7. Care: Minimal maintenance; deadhead spent flowers to encourage prolonged blooming and maintain garden health.
